- Telekom mobilszolgáltatások
- A Watch7-tel debütálhat a Samsung vércukormérője
- Fotók, videók mobillal
- iPhone topik
- Garmin Forerunner 165 - alapozó edzés
- Samsung Galaxy S24 Ultra - ha működik, ne változtass!
- Samsung Galaxy S23 és S23+ - ami belül van, az számít igazán
- Bemutatkozott a Redmi új szériája
- Oppo Find X5 Pro - megtalálták
- Bluetooth-headsetekről általában
Hirdetés
-
Ülésezik a hardveregylet
ph Az irodai készülékek és monitorok társaságát egy ház, egy egér és egy DAC egészíti ki.
-
Lenovo Essential Wireless Combo
lo Lehet-e egy billentyűzet karcsú, elegáns és különleges? A Lenovo bebizonyította, hogy igen, de bosszantó is :)
-
Olcsó 5G-s ajánlatot nyújt a Realme Indiának
ma Megérkezett a Realme C65 5G, az első készülék a MediaTek Dimensity 6300-zal.
Új hozzászólás Aktív témák
-
Karma
félisten
válasz kemkriszt98 #2250 üzenetére
installLocation elem kéne a manifestbe.
“All nothings are not equal.”
-
h1ght3chzor
őstag
Main-ben meghívok 2 fv-t, hogyan tudom megcsinálni, hogy amíg az első nem fut le, a második ne induljon el?
Kérlek tisztelj meg azzal, hogy válaszolsz a privát üzenetre.
-
h1ght3chzor
őstag
válasz h1ght3chzor #2253 üzenetére
Megoldva közben...
Másik kérdésem az lenne, hogy van egy szálam, melyben van egy while(true), hogyan tudom megoldani, hogy ebben a ciklusban is várakozzak vmennyi másodpercet?
Kérlek tisztelj meg azzal, hogy válaszolsz a privát üzenetre.
-
Karma
félisten
válasz h1ght3chzor #2254 üzenetére
De komolyan? Nem desktopon, középiskolai programozásórán vagy, hogy időzítve várakozzál eseményekre. De ha nagyon akarod, akkor a Thread.sleep() metódus jó erre.
“All nothings are not equal.”
-
h1ght3chzor
őstag
Ha thread.sleep-et hívok, akkor miközben a szállal újabb műveletet szeretnék végezni, akkor nem tud, mivel nem aktív. És nem eseményre szeretnék várni,hanem egyszerűn mondjuk egy println()-t szeretnék kiíratni mondjuk 10 másodpercenként a while ciklusban.
[ Szerkesztve ]
Kérlek tisztelj meg azzal, hogy válaszolsz a privát üzenetre.
-
WonderCSabo
félisten
válasz h1ght3chzor #2257 üzenetére
Kérdésem, hogy ennek mi köze az Androidhoz?
Egyébként pedig javaslom a wait-notify megismerését.De ha már Android, Handler postDelayed metódusával tudsz késleltetni végrehajtást.
-
Karma
félisten
válasz h1ght3chzor #2257 üzenetére
Az előbb még várakoztatni akartad a szálat... Inkább azt írd le, hogy mit szeretnél csinálni, minthogy implementációs részleteken pörögjünk egy fél oldalon át.
Egyébként ha már implementáció, a Handler postDelayed egy sokkal jobb válasz. Ha eltekintünk attól, hogy minden ami ciklikusan ismétlődik, mobilon nem jó.
[ Szerkesztve ]
“All nothings are not equal.”
-
h1ght3chzor
őstag
WonderCSabo: semmi köze androidhoz, inkább java, az tény
Nem a szálat szeretném várakoztatni, hanem a while(true)-ban tegyük fel van egy kiíratás, és azt, tehát hogy ne írja ki folyamatosan, hanem csak X időközönként.
Kérlek tisztelj meg azzal, hogy válaszolsz a privát üzenetre.
-
WonderCSabo
félisten
válasz h1ght3chzor #2260 üzenetére
Tehát most azt szeretnéd, hogy minden kiíratást később tegyen meg, vagy azt, hogy csak minden n. elemet írjon ki idő függvényében?
-
Karma
félisten
válasz h1ght3chzor #2260 üzenetére
Heh, ez pont ugyanaz mint amit az előbb írtál.
Tégy egy lépést hátrébb és azt írd le, hogy mire lesz ez jó.“All nothings are not equal.”
-
h1ght3chzor
őstag
-
h1ght3chzor
őstag
válasz h1ght3chzor #2263 üzenetére
Úgy néz ki megoldva, több féle megoldást is próbáltam de se wait, sleep, és társai nem voltak jó, mivel a szálam kellett, hogy fusson folyamatosan.
public static void pause(int seconds){
Date start = new Date();
Date end = new Date();
while(end.getTime() - start.getTime() < seconds * 1000){
end = new Date();
}
}Fv-el csináltam meg a végén, hátha valakit érdekel.
Kérlek tisztelj meg azzal, hogy válaszolsz a privát üzenetre.
-
WonderCSabo
félisten
válasz h1ght3chzor #2264 üzenetére
Ez még rosszabb mint a sleep. Ez a busy waiting egy állatorvosi fajtája.
-
eastsider
nagyúr
válasz WonderCSabo #2265 üzenetére
nem mertem mondani
ilyenkor kellene a lentebb említett Handler nem? -
Karma
félisten
válasz h1ght3chzor #2264 üzenetére
Jézus ereje... Ezt így semmiképpen se hagyd, ezért még desktopon is felnégyelnek, teljesen jogosan. Nézd meg a telefon CPU használatát a DDMS perspektíván, szép lesz...
Ne erőltesd a végtelen ciklust, szerintem elég volt a játékból. Írj egy Runnable-t és használj Handlert! Nincs Android környezetem most kéznél, de valahogy így nézne ki:
public class FapapucsActivity extends Activity {
private Handler mHander = new Handler();
private Runnable mScheduled = new Runnable() {
public void run() {
Log.d("FapapucsActivity", "PING!");
mHandler.postDelayed(mScheduled, 60000);
}
};
public void onResume(...) {
mHandler.postDelayed(mScheduled, 60000);
}
public void onPause(...) {
mHandler.removeCallbacks(mScheduled);
}
}Az ismétlődés kulcsa, hogy a Runnable végén újra felírja önmagát.
[ Szerkesztve ]
“All nothings are not equal.”
-
Sianis
addikt
Hali!
Látott már valaki értelmes megvalósításban Quick return patternt + ListView-t? A helyzet a következő. Van egy View (vagy adott esetben több, mindegy) egy ListView felett. Ha lefelé görget akkor el kell rejteni, animálva, ha felfelé akkor visszahozni. Ez a dolog egészen odáig fejben nekem oké is volt, hogy kiúsztatom, vissza, viszont mindig a ListView felé úszik. Úgy kellene nekem, hogy a ListView teteje igazodjon a View aljához. Erre látott már valaki példát?
Köszi!
Sianis
-
Benex
senior tag
Sziasztok , van egy kis programom ami tartalmaz 2 gombot Max volume és Min volume. Értelem szerüen az egyik gomb minden hangot maxra vesz a másik meg mindent nullára. (Kivéve a telefonálás hangereje, azaz hogy ha feéhivnak ne kelljen azt állítani).
Viszont barátnőm felhivta figyelmemet , hogy ez igen iskolába jól jön h ha netán le is veszi ahangot de pl ha játszana és ott nem vette le , akkor baj van , és mennyivel egyszerübb lenne egy widget, hogy ne kelljen a programot megnyitni.Widgetet még nem csináltam sose. tegnap kezdtem neki de sehogy sem halad. Valami segitséget kérhetek hogy hogy lehetne megvalósitani hogy: Egy togglebuton a widget aminek a szövege Mute ON/Mute OFF, és ennyiből álna az egész.(És ehhez a widget.class-ba külön meg kell irni a hang fel illetev le vevős kódot, vagy lehet a másik osztályból hivatkozni rá?)
Előre köszönöma segítségeteket!!!!
Proud owner of S21Ultra and Watch 4
-
-
Sianis
addikt
válasz WonderCSabo #2272 üzenetére
Ezeknek a megértésével próbálkozom amúgy, éppen
Sianis
-
Karma
félisten
válasz h1ght3chzor #2274 üzenetére
"Azt nem mondták, hogy nem a foga fáj!"
Mondjuk ettől még a busy wait továbbra se járja. Van szofisztikáltabb megoldás: Timer és TimerTask például, amik Androidon nem szerencsések, de desktopon elfér.
“All nothings are not equal.”
-
WonderCSabo
félisten
válasz h1ght3chzor #2276 üzenetére
Mondjuk legközelebb akkor a Java topikban tedd fel a kérdést, ha semmi köze az Androidhoz.
-
eastsider
nagyúr
Sziasztok!
Loadernek szeretnék készíteni egy queryt, olyan módon, hogy checkboxszal aktiválható az az input elem (a konstansok resourceből jönnek), amely alapján szűrni szeretne ÉS egy vagy több feltételt lehet megadni.
hogy lehetne ezt szépen megoldani?
egyébként egy dialogFragmentből adódnak át az értékek a ListFragmentben lévő loadernek.
igaziból az AND operátort nem tudom hogy kellene hozzáadni a feltétellistához, mert ugye több feltétel alapján lehet szűrniszóval select * from table where name="param1" AND age="param" AND stbstb;
[ Szerkesztve ]
-
letepem
aktív tag
Sziasztok!
Kis gondom akadt az expandable list-tel! Miért van az, ha gombot szeretnék rakni a list_group.xml-be (főmenü) vagy a list_item.xml-be (almenü), akkor már nem működik se legördülés, se az almenü onclick listener?
[így kezelem le ]Köszi előre is!
[ Szerkesztve ]
látok, hallok, érzek és gondolkodom.
-
eastsider
nagyúr
Sziasztok!
R.java eltűnése esetén van valami workaround?
akartam exportálni az apk-t és látom, hogy nem engedi,pedig előtte debugoltam telefonon..
látom, hogy eltűnt az R.java, és nem generálja magának újra
itt próbáltam mindent: [link]
nem toltam cleant előtte -
eastsider
nagyúr
válasz WonderCSabo #2282 üzenetére
-
coco2
őstag
Sziasztok! Egy kérdésem lenne. Android 4.x alkalmazásból a filerendszer legfelső szintjéhez szeretnék hozzáférni. Java alkalmazásból kellene csinálni, behekkelni a linuxba alatta macerásabb a kelleténél. Milyen eszközök vannak erre kitalálva?
កុំភ្លេចប្រើភាសាអង់គ្លេសក្នុងបរិយាកាសអន្តរជាតិ។
-
szunyi777
őstag
Sziasztok
Kellene egy kis segitség.
Van egy portolt Fényképező alkalamzás AOSP romokra, nevezetesen a LenovoSC
Minden hibátlanul fut, de egy dolog idegesit benne... Amikor elinditom, kiirja egy felugró menüben, hogy ez nem az én készülékemre való..... És egy OK nyomásra eltűnik...
Ezt szeretném kiszedni belőle.
Kibontottam az appot frankón APKTOOL_Beta9-el, és a kérdésem, hogy hol kellene nekiállnom keresni ezt a programkódot ?
Headers-ben esetleg?
Gondolom Eclipse nélkül is meglehet oldani..
Köszi előre is..Samsung Galaxy S20 Ultra >Rom: Beyond 2.1 Android 11>Kernel: STOCK >Recovery: TWRP (ROOTED)>EdXposed>Viper4Android hangmotor>- https://www.facebook.com/Mobiltelefonszervizszeged/
-
Karma
félisten
válasz szunyi777 #2285 üzenetére
Ennél azért lényegesen bonyolultabb a folyamat, a lefordított kódot vissza és újra kell fordítanod, amire az ApkTool önmagában nem hiszem, hogy elég lenne.
Először is kéne a pontos, eredeti nyelvű szöveg, mert így lehetetlen megtalálni a kiindulási pontot.
“All nothings are not equal.”
-
szunyi777
őstag
Köszi a választ..
Félek én is, hogy Eclipse lesz a kulcs...
Melyik szövegre gondolsz, amit feldob induláskor?Samsung Galaxy S20 Ultra >Rom: Beyond 2.1 Android 11>Kernel: STOCK >Recovery: TWRP (ROOTED)>EdXposed>Viper4Android hangmotor>- https://www.facebook.com/Mobiltelefonszervizszeged/
-
nagyúr
Sziasztok! Milyen androidos könyveket ajánlotok? Alapvetően nem olyan kéne ami az androidon keresztül tanít meg programozni, hanem ami konkrétan az android sajátosságaival foglalkozik.
-
trisztan94
őstag
Pedig a legjobb szakirodalmak angolul vannak.
Érdemes lehet belefektetni egy olcsó tabletbe, vagy ebook olvasóba, nagyon kényelmes azon olvasni és a Google Books / iTunes / Kindle párossal szinte nincs olyan könyv, amit ne lehetne elérni, a papíros árának sokszor töredékéért.
Én iPad-et használtam, szinte kizárólag erre, nagyon meg voltam elégedve vele. Jobb volt, mint egy könyv szvsz.
https://heureka-kreativ.hu
-
nagyúr
válasz trisztan94 #2293 üzenetére
Tudom, de az angol olvasás lefáraszt agyilag. Sajnos csak középfokum van és nem zsigerből fordítok
Nem veszek ebook olvasot, most kocsira gyujtok
[ Szerkesztve ]
-
raggg
senior tag
Először lassan megy, de ha hozzászoksz elég nagy előnyben vagy azokkal szemben, akik csak a magyar szakirodalmat olvassák; ami nem csak hogy sokszor hibás (rosszul van fordítva vagy lektorálva) de nem is feltétlen a legjobb könyveket vonultatja fel.
Egyébként ha könyvet szoktam keresni akkor amazon-on vadászom az értékeléseket, nagyjából azért ki lehet deríteni minden könyvről hogy mennyire érdemes pénzt/időt 'pazarolni' rá. :-)
ragklaatPS
-
nagyúr
Koszi mindenkinek, megprobalok angol jegyzet/konyv utan nezni.
-
Mr.Csizmás
félisten
üdv,
androidos fejlesztőt keresek egy innovatív koncepció megvalósításához, egy OpenStreetMap API-t használó célprogram pályázatához.
"Szólítson csak Cirminek." | B&B XI | 3D nyomtatás Bp és környéke |
-
nagyúr
Ez a proguard cucc nagyon bejon, csak egy kerdesem lenne. Visszafejtes utan nem minden osztalyt nevez at, nehanynak meghagyja a nevet. Ez ellen lehet valamit tenni?
Új hozzászólás Aktív témák
- A régi node-okra koncentrál a szankciók miatt Kína
- Magga: PLEX: multimédia az egész lakásban
- Azonnali VGA-s kérdések órája
- Windows 11
- Székesfehérvár és környéke adok-veszek-beszélgetek
- Facebook és Messenger
- Autós topik
- Mozilla Firefox
- HP notebook topic
- Azonnali informatikai kérdések órája
- További aktív témák...
- LG NanoCell 55NANO766QA Halvány píxel csík
- Philips 58PUS8545/12 1 ÉV GARANCIA Játék üzemmód
- Tyű-ha! HP EliteBook 850 G7 Fémházas Szuper Strapabíró Laptop 15,6" -65% i7-10610U 32/512 FHD HUN
- Bomba ár! HP EliteBook 840 G5 - i5-8G I 8GB I 128GB SSD I 14" FHD I HDMI I Cam I W10 I Gari!
- The Last of Us Part I Ps5